RMPR9CA ;OI-HINES/HNC -SUSPENSE RPC;12/27/2004
Source file <RMPR9CA.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
Prosthetics | 2 | RMPR DELETE PO RMPR SUSPENSE ACTIONS |
Name | Comments | DBIA/ICR reference |
---|---|---|
A1 | ;roll and scroll entry point
|
|
EN(RESULTS,RMIE68,RMPRDUZ,RMSUSTAT,RMPR664,RMPRTXT) | ;RPC entry point
|
|
A2 | ;
|
|
CONT | ;RMSUSTAT is status 1=complete or 0=incomplete or 2=pending (incomplete)
|
|
CNOTE | ;(#12) COMPLETION NOTE
|
|
ONOTE | ;Other note
|
|
INOTE | ;initial action note
|
|
FD | ;file date
|
|
UPD | ;update file 668 with 2319 records
|
|
A3 | ||
EN1(RESULTS,DA) | ;Broker entry to kill PO
|
|
A4 | ;
|
|
ERR | ;exit on error
|
|
EXIT | ;
|
RPC Name | Call Tags |
---|---|
RMPR SUSPENSE ACTIONS | EN |
RMPR DELETE PO | EN1 |
FileNo | Call Tags |
---|---|
^VA(200 - [#200] | GETS^DIQ |
^RMPR(664 - [#664] | Classic Fileman Calls |
^RMPR(668 - [#668] | Classic Fileman Calls |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^RMPR(660 - [#660] | FD+8, FD+13, FD+45 |
^RMPR(664 - [#664] | CONT+3, CONT+4 |
^RMPR(668 - [#668] | CNOTE+7, CNOTE+19*, CNOTE+21*, CNOTE+24, CNOTE+30, CNOTE+33, CNOTE+34, ONOTE+28*, ONOTE+30*, ONOTE+32 , ONOTE+35, ONOTE+36, INOTE+7, INOTE+10*, INOTE+17*, INOTE+19*, INOTE+25, INOTE+28, INOTE+29, FD+10 , FD+11, FD+12 |
^TMP($J | A2+2!, CONT+5* |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
% | CNOTE+9, ONOTE+9, INOTE+8, EXIT+3! |
BAD | EXIT+3! |
BDC | CNOTE+41*, CNOTE+42, EXIT+3! |
DA | CNOTE+8*, CNOTE+24, ONOTE+8*, ONOTE+17*, ONOTE+38!, INOTE+22*, EN1~ |
DA(1 | ONOTE+8*, UPD+1*, UPD+2, UPD+6*, UPD+7 |
DD | UPD+1!, UPD+5!, UPD+10! |
DIC | ONOTE+10*, FD+1~, UPD+1!, UPD+2*, UPD+5!, UPD+7*, UPD+10! |
DIC("P" | ONOTE+12* |
DIC(0 | ONOTE+11*, UPD+3*, UPD+6* |
DIE | CNOTE+10*, CNOTE+25*, ONOTE+19!, INOTE+21*, FD+1~ |
DIK | EN1+2*, EN1+3! |
DLAYGO | ONOTE+13*, FD+2~, UPD+3*, UPD+6*, UPD+10! |
DO | UPD+1!, UPD+5!, UPD+10! |
DR | CNOTE+11*, CNOTE+26*, CNOTE+28*, ONOTE+19!, INOTE+23*, FD+2~ |
DT | INOTE+10 |
DUZ | CNOTE+40, ONOTE+37, INOTE+30 |
GMRCA | CNOTE+37*, CNOTE+41, CNOTE+43! |
GMRCAD | CNOTE+9*, CNOTE+41, CNOTE+43! |
GMRCALF | CNOTE+38*, CNOTE+41, CNOTE+43! |
GMRCATO | CNOTE+39*, CNOTE+41, CNOTE+43! |
GMRCDUZ | CNOTE+40*, CNOTE+41, CNOTE+43! |
GMRCMT | INOTE+30, INOTE+31! |
GMRCMT( | INOTE+29* |
GMRCO | CNOTE+30*, CNOTE+31, CNOTE+41, CNOTE+43!, ONOTE+32*, ONOTE+33, ONOTE+37, ONOTE+38!, INOTE+25*, INOTE+26 , INOTE+30, INOTE+31! |
GMRCOM | CNOTE+35*, CNOTE+41, CNOTE+43!, ONOTE+37, ONOTE+38! |
GMRCOM( | CNOTE+34*, ONOTE+36* |
GMRCORNP | CNOTE+40*, CNOTE+41, CNOTE+43! |
GMRCSF | CNOTE+36*, CNOTE+41, CNOTE+43! |
GMRCWHN | ONOTE+9*, ONOTE+37, ONOTE+38! |
I | FD+1~ |
J | FD+1~ |
L | CNOTE+13*, CNOTE+14*, CNOTE+16, CNOTE+17, CNOTE+19, CNOTE+22!, ONOTE+22*, ONOTE+23*, ONOTE+25, ONOTE+26 , ONOTE+28, ONOTE+31!, INOTE+11*, INOTE+12*, INOTE+14, INOTE+15, INOTE+17, INOTE+20! |
LN | CNOTE+13*, CNOTE+15, CNOTE+19*, CNOTE+21, CNOTE+22!, ONOTE+22*, ONOTE+24, ONOTE+28*, ONOTE+30, ONOTE+31! , INOTE+11*, INOTE+13, INOTE+17*, INOTE+19, INOTE+20! |
RC | FD+1~ |
RESULTS | EN~, EN1~ |
RESULTS(0 | A2+1*, CNOTE+7*, CNOTE+31*, CNOTE+42*, CNOTE+44*, ONOTE+15*, ONOTE+33*, ONOTE+39*, INOTE+7*, INOTE+26* , INOTE+32*, FD+9* |
RM60CNT | FD+3~ |
RM60DAT | FD+2~ |
RM60IEN | FD+3~ |
RM60IT | FD+4~ |
RM60L | FD+1~ |
RM60TYP | FD+4~ |
RM668 | FD+2~ |
RM680 | FD+1~, FD+10*, FD+15, FD+16, FD+17, FD+18, FD+19, FD+20, FD+21, FD+23 |
RM6810 | FD+1~, FD+12* |
RM688 | FD+11*, FD+26, FD+27, EXIT+2! |
RM68CNT | FD+3~ |
RM68D | FD+4~ |
RM68DATA | FD+4~ |
RM68IEN | FD+3~ |
RM68TRAN | FD+4~ |
RMAA | EXIT+2! |
RMAA(200 | FD+25 |
RMAMIS | FD+13*, UPD+8, EXIT+2! |
RMCHK | FD+2~ |
RMCODT | FD+16*, FD+32, EXIT+2! |
RMD | FD+3~ |
RMDAT | EXIT+2! |
RMDAT(660 | FD+29*, FD+30*, FD+31*, FD+32*, FD+33*, FD+34*, FD+35*, FD+36*, FD+37*, FD+38* , FD+39*, FD+40*, FD+41* |
RMDATE | FD+1~, FD+15*, FD+29 |
RMDFN | FD+1~ |
RMDWRT | FD+19*, FD+30, EXIT+2! |
RMENTSUS | FD+4~ |
RMEQU | EXIT+1! |
RMERR | FD+2~, FD+6*, FD+43* |
RMERROR | FD+1~, FD+43 |
RMGMRCO | INOTE+31! |
RMI | FD+1~ |
RMICD9 | FD+27*, FD+37, EXIT+2! |
RMIE | CONT+2*, CONT+3*, CONT+4, EXIT+2! |
RMIE60 | CONT+4*, CONT+5, FD+8, FD+13, FD+29, FD+30, FD+31, FD+32, FD+33, FD+34 , FD+35, FD+36, FD+37, FD+38, FD+39, FD+40, FD+41, FD+45, UPD+3, EXIT+2! |
RMIE68 | EN~, CNOTE+7, CNOTE+8, CNOTE+19, CNOTE+21, CNOTE+30, CNOTE+33, CNOTE+34, ONOTE+8, ONOTE+10 , ONOTE+28, ONOTE+30, ONOTE+32, ONOTE+35, ONOTE+36, INOTE+7, INOTE+10, INOTE+17, INOTE+19, INOTE+22 , INOTE+25, INOTE+28, INOTE+29, FD+10, FD+11, FD+12, UPD+1, UPD+6, EXIT+1! |
RMINDT | FD+17*, FD+31, EXIT+3! |
RMPR664 | EN~, CONT+3, CONT+4, EXIT+1! |
RMPRC | CNOTE+12~, CNOTE+15, CNOTE+16*, CNOTE+17, ONOTE+21~, ONOTE+24, ONOTE+25*, ONOTE+26, INOTE+9~, INOTE+13 , INOTE+14*, INOTE+15 |
RMPRCMT | INOTE+27*, INOTE+28*, INOTE+29, INOTE+31! |
RMPRCO | FD+18*, FD+38, EXIT+1! |
RMPRCOM | CNOTE+32*, CNOTE+33*, CNOTE+34, ONOTE+34*, ONOTE+35*, ONOTE+36, ONOTE+38! |
RMPRDA1 | ONOTE+8*, ONOTE+38! |
RMPRDA2 | ONOTE+17*, ONOTE+28, ONOTE+30, ONOTE+35, ONOTE+36, ONOTE+38! |
RMPRDI | FD+26*, FD+36, EXIT+1! |
RMPRDUZ | EN~, EXIT+1! |
RMPREODT | CNOTE+9*, CNOTE+29!, INOTE+8*, INOTE+30, INOTE+31! |
RMPREQU | EXIT+3! |
RMPRPRC | FD+4~ |
RMPRTST | EXIT+1! |
RMPRTXT | EN~, EXIT+2! |
RMPRTXT( | CNOTE+14, CNOTE+16, CNOTE+17*, CNOTE+19, ONOTE+23, ONOTE+25, ONOTE+26*, ONOTE+28, INOTE+12, INOTE+14 , INOTE+15*, INOTE+17 |
RMQUIT | FD+4~ |
>> RMREQU | FD+23*, FD+25, FD+34 |
RMSAMIS | FD+3~ |
RMSERV | FD+24*, FD+25*, FD+35, EXIT+1! |
RMSI | FD+3~ |
RMSTAT | FD+20*, FD+39, EXIT+1! |
RMSTATUS | FD+2~ |
RMSUS60 | FD+3~ |
RMSUS68 | FD+3~ |
RMSUSTAT | EN~, CONT+9, CONT+10, CONT+11, FD+7*, FD+40, FD+41, EXIT+1! |
RMTRES | FD+21*, FD+22, EXIT+1! |
RMTYRE | FD+22*, FD+33, EXIT+1! |
STP | A2+1*, CONT+3, CONT+6, CONT+8, FD+9*, FD+43*, EXIT+3! |
U | CONT+4, CNOTE+7, CNOTE+24, CNOTE+30, CNOTE+42, ONOTE+32, INOTE+25, FD+13, FD+15, FD+16 , FD+17, FD+18, FD+19, FD+20, FD+21, FD+23, FD+26, FD+27 |
X | ONOTE+9*, FD+2~, UPD+3*, UPD+5!, UPD+8*, UPD+10! |
Y | ONOTE+15, ONOTE+17, ONOTE+19!, FD+1~ |